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Dusted's "Property Lines" have a sense of wandering and disorientation. The singer seems to be exploring an area by following the property lines, possibly lost or unsure of where to go. The reference to "cold breath time" could suggest a winter landscape or a sense of foreboding. As the singer moves through this space, they have forgotten their sense of direction, perhaps indicating a lack of purpose or motivation.


The lines "Thank you, I need you whole / Under past I heard the girl" add a sense of mystery to the song. It's unclear who the "you" is that the singer is thanking, or who the girl from the past represents. The lyrics imply some sort of connection or dependency, but the nature of that connection is left up to interpretation.


Overall, "Property Lines" paints a picture of someone adrift in a confusing space, trying to make sense of their surroundings and their place within them. It's a song that invites reflection and introspection, challenging listeners to consider their own relationship to the world around them.
